HF HNO 2 Answer a … The phosphate ion has a molar mass of 94.97 g/mol, and consists of a central phosphorus atom surrounded by four oxygen atoms in a tetrahedral arrangement. It is the conjugate base of the hydrogen phosphate ion H(PO 4) , which in turn is the conjugate base of the dihydrogen phosphate ion H 2(PO 4) , which in turn is the conjugate base of orthophosphoric acid, H 3PO 4.
WebPhosphorous acid (or phosphonic acid (singular)) is the compound described by the formula H 3 PO 3. This acid is diprotic (readily ionizes two protons), not triprotic as might be suggested by this formula. Phosphorous acid is an intermediate in the preparation of other phosphorus compounds. WebSep 23, 2024 · Phosphoric acid is H3PO4. When it ionizes it forms H+ (cation) and H2PO4^1- (anion).
